Can a EVGA 770 handle 3 monitors?

If so, how much VRAM will I need? I will NOT be gaming on all 3, just the one in the middle.

How would I go about setting up 3 ASUS VX238H monitors if they only have hdmi inputs?

Can someone link me to the appropriate cables?

memory only matters if your gaming. Its irrelevant for normal desktop work. A 2GB card is fine. And you'll need DVI to HDMI adapters or cables.
